Senator Natasha Accuses Akpabio of Using Immigration to Seize Her Passport
Senator Natasha Akpoti-Uduaghan of Kogi Central has alleged that Senate President Godswill Akpabio directed Nigerian immigration officers to confiscate her international passport at the airport, stopping her from travelling abroad. A facebook live video on Tuesday shows the lawmaker confronting immigration officials after her passport was withheld.
In the video, Senator Akpoti-Uduaghan lammented what she called an ongoing effort to restrict her movement, claiming the same incident had occurred previously without any legal justification. She said officers informed her that the order came from Akpabio, who accused her of damaging Nigeria’s image through interviews with international media. The senator urged authorities to end what she called continuous harassment and intimidation.
As of press time, the Nigerian Immigration Service and the office of the Senate President had not commented on the allegations.
